Land Rover Asheville Named Top Land Rover Retailer in U.S.
9 May 2000
FLETCHER, N.C. - At a ceremony on Saturday, May 6, 2000, retailer principal Jack L. Frasher, Centre manager Roger Miller and the staff of Land Rover Asheville were presented with the Land Rover Trophy, an annual award recognizing the top-performing Land Rover retailer in North America. The impressive bronze sculpture, a traveling trophy that features plaques commemorating former winners, will reside at the western North Carolina-based Land Rover retailer until another Land Rover Trophy winner is selected. The Land Rover Trophy is the highest award possible in Land Rover's Marque of Distinction program, which was launched in 1996 as an effort to recognize excellence among Land Rover's many retailers. Sixteen measurements-assessing everything from customer satisfaction to market penetration-are used to gauge the performance of Land Rover's 121 U.S. retailers for the Marque of Distinction program. In the past twelve months, Land Rover Asheville accumulated 8,694 points out a possible 10,000, registering very high scores in areas such as customer satisfaction, sales satisfaction and market penetration. Land Rover Asheville, located on Highway 280 near the Asheville Regional Airport, employs 14 people and opened in January 1998. As a small but growing Centre, Land Rover Asheville exceeds national and regional market penetration levels. Land Rover North America, Inc., established in 1986, imports Range Rover and Discovery Series II vehicles manufactured in Solihull, England, for sale in the U.S. and is a wholly owned subsidiary of The BMW Group, Munich, Germany.
